At age 54 I got my first Discover card in January and they gave me $9.5k limit and 10.9% APR after the promotional period. I hit the "LUV button" on 4/15 - $1k increase. I only waited a week and tried the Luv button again and was denied. I'm going to be away next week and decided to call Discover instead. I asked if it was HP or SP. He said it would be SP unless they need some further reason to HP and would tell me first. He congratulated me and said I was approved for another $1k today. So, I will tray again on 5/20 with the Luv button. This is becoming by far my favorite rewards card.
I did learn a couple of things tonight. When he asked me about income I told him between my wife and I what our combined income is. He said he had to look at a chart and said that for Pennsylvania, I can only report my annual income. I said well that's interesting, I'd never heard that before, which I never read discussed here on myFICO. He asked me if we have a mortgage and I affirmed we do but told him my wife and I both share the payment, so he ran it as $600 instead of $1,100. So, that's what I'll do in the future too.
